What Is Body Contouring?

Body contouring involves surgical or non-surgical procedures that change the shape of the body. These procedures are commonly used to address excess fat, loose skin, or cellulite in order to improve the body’s appearance. Body contouring can target areas such as the abdomen, arms, thighs, buttocks, and breasts.

Who Can Benefit from Body Contouring?

Anyone who is unhappy with their body’s appearance and has realistic expectations about the outcome can benefit from body contouring. It is especially beneficial for those who have undergone major weight loss and are left with sagging skin or stubborn pockets of fat that cannot be eliminated through diet and exercise.

Types of Body Contouring

There are various types of body contouring procedures, each targeting specific areas of the body. Some common types include the following.

  • Liposuction:This procedure involves using specialized tools to remove excess fat through suction.
  • Tummy Tuck:Also known as abdominoplasty, this procedure removes excess skin and fat from the abdomen area to give a flatter and more toned appearance.
  • Arm Lift:This surgery removes excess skin and fat from the upper arms to improve their shape and appearance.
  • Thigh Lift:A thigh lift involves removing excess skin and fat from the thighs to create a smoother and more toned appearance.
  • Breast Lift:This procedure involves lifting sagging breasts to give them a more youthful and perkier look.
  • Brazilian Butt Lift:A Brazilian butt lift uses fat transfer techniques to enhance the shape and size of the buttocks.

Potential Risks

Like any surgical procedure, body contouring also carries some risks. These can include scarring, bleeding, infection, asymmetry, and changes in sensation. Recovery Process

The recovery process after body contouring varies depending on the type of procedure performed. Generally, patients can expect some swelling, bruising, and discomfort that can last for a few weeks. It is important to follow all post-operative care instructions provided by your surgeon to ensure proper healing and minimize complications.

During the recovery period, it is essential to avoid strenuous physical activities and wear compression garments as recommended by your surgeon. It may take several months for the final results of body contouring to be visible, but most patients are satisfied with their new body contours and improved self-confidence.
